Transaction 58ca3ba20adea4c6c19a953cb794ee66b26a2f083f12aa89353e2d0c6f35ffe6

1 Input
2 Outputs
  • 58ca3ba20adea4c6c19a953cb794ee66b26a2f083f12aa89353e2d0c6f35ffe6:0
  • value  1752873
    address  36aDT9qshXUBtVx1sC4fP1oWr1M5SWtrfN
  • 58ca3ba20adea4c6c19a953cb794ee66b26a2f083f12aa89353e2d0c6f35ffe6:1
  • value  4415233
    address  16NDAuDQKKEzs8rzQMVTQgKn7evrma857g